Here’s another great idea for lunch…taking the classic Oriental Salad (you know, the one with the ramen noodles) and changing it up a bit. I’ve replaced the ramen with crispy wonton strips and added cherry tomatoes and fresh flaked tuna…then topped it with a yummy Ginger Soy Dressing…
Oriental Tuna Salad with Ginger Soy Dressing
1 pkg 14 oz Old Fashioned Coleslaw Mix
2 cups Crispy Wonton Strips
2 cups Sliced Almonds
1 cup slivered red onion
30 cherry tomatoes cut into halves
2 cans 5 oz solid white Albacore in water
Ginger Soy Dressing
2 tablespoons soy sauce
1 tablespoon white wine vinegar
1/4 tsp ground ginger
1/4 tsp Chinese Five Spice
1/2 tsp salt
1 tablespoon brown sugar
1/2 cup extra virgin olive oil
In a large bowl combine the coleslaw mix, wonton strips, sliced almonds, slivered red onion, cherry tomato halves. Drain the tuna and flake – then add to the bowl. Make the Ginger Soy Dressing. In a jar with a lid, combine all the ingredients. Put the lid on the jar and shake vigorously. Pour dressing over the Oriental Tuna Salad and toss gently. Makes 4-6 servings.
